Characteristic Symbol FR801 FR802 FR803 FR804 FR805 Unit
Maximum Recurrent Peak Reverse Voltage VRRM 50 100 200 400 600 V
Maximum RMS Voltage VRMS 35 70 140 280 420 V
Maximum DC Blocking voltage VDC 50 100 200 400 600 V
Maximum Average Forward Rectified Current
0.375" (9.5mm) Lead Length @ TC= 100°C I(AV) 8.0 A
Peak Forward Surge Current 8.3ms single half sine-wave
superimposed on rated load (JEDEC Method) IFSM 150 A
Maximum Instantaneous Forward Voltage @ 8.0A DC VF1.3 V
Maximum DC Reverse Current at Rated DC Blocking Voltage
@ TA= 25°C IR10 µA
Maximum Full Load Reverse Current Full Cycle
@ TC= 100°C IR150 µA
Maximum Reverse Recovery Time (Note 1) Trr 150 250 ns
Typical Junction Capacitance (Note 2) CJ70 pF
Operating and Storage Temperature Range TJ,T
STG -65 to +175 °C
Notes: 1. Reverse Recovery Test Conditions: IF=0.5 A, IR=1.0 A, IRR =0.25 A
2. Measured at 1.0MHz and applied reverse voltage of 4.0V.
